VAR denies Borussia Mönchengladbach a crucial win against RB Leipzig

Borussia Mönchengladbach were held to a goalless draw by RB Leipzig, but the real drama of the night unfolded around VAR — once again at the heart of a Bundesliga controversy.

The match’s turning point came early in the second half when a seemingly legitimate goal by Frank Honorat was ruled out for a marginal offside in the 47th minute. Later, in the 74th minute, referee decisions took center stage again as a previously awarded penalty to Gladbach was overturned after a lengthy video review.

Head coach Eugen Polanski did not hide his frustration, calling the offside line “highly questionable” and criticizing the prolonged VAR checks, adding that such interruptions “kill the spirit of the sport.” Despite the tension and a flurry of emotional moments, the scoreboard stayed frozen at 0–0 — with VAR once more overshadowing the football itself.
